Shooting at St. Louis gas station leaves one dead, child in critical condition

Image source - Pexels.com

ST. LOUIS — Police responded to a shooting Wednesday night that resulted in the death of one man and left a six-year-old in critical condition. The child and the man did not know each other.

The incident occurred around 11 p.m. in the 8800 block of North Broadway, inside the Convenience Express gas station. Two men entered the store and opened fire, injuring a 34-year-old man and the six-year-old boy. The man was later taken to the hospital and pronounced dead.

Both suspects remain at large. Anyone with information is urged to contact local police or CrimeStoppers at 1-866-371-8477.
